In this article, we propose updated evidence and future directions of antithrombotic treatment in East Asian patients.Epigastric hernias are relatively uncommon in children, and there is a paucity of literature on their incidence, presenting features, natural history, and surgical outcomes. A systematic review was conducted according to PRISMA guidelines. Articles describing the incidence, outcome, and interventions for pediatric epigastric hernias, both open and laparoscopic, were analyzed. Eight relevant articles published between 1975 and 2019 were included in the analysis. Of 81 children, 58% were females, 35% were symptomatic and 8% were multiple. All hernias contained preperitoneal fat only and were repaired using standard open surgery or laparoscopic techniques. No recurrences were recorded. In a personal series of 37 hernias in 36 children of median age 4 years, there were no recurrences; however, this series included two children with a recurrent or persistent epigastric hernia after surgery by others. Epigastric hernias in children are relatively uncommon. They typically contain only preperitoneal fat but more than a third are symptomatic. Standard open repair can be undertaken with minimal morbidity. Laparoscopic repair takes longer and provides a marginal cosmetic benefit.

 Studies report contradicting results on the incidence of infantile hypertrophic pyloric stenosis (IHPS) and its association with seasons. We aim to assess the IHPS incidence in the Netherlands and to determine whether seasonal variation is present in a nationwide cohort.

 All infants with IHPS hospitalized in the Netherlands between 2007 and 2017 were included in this retrospective cohort study. Incidence rates per 1,000 livebirths (LB) were calculated using total number of LB during the matched month, season, or year, respectively. Seasonal variation based on month of birth and month of surgery was analyzed using linear mixed model and one-way ANOVA, respectively.

 A total of 2,479 infants were included, of which the majority was male (75.9%). Median (interquartile range) age at surgery was 34 (18) days. The average IHPS incidence rate was 1.28 per 1,000 LB (variation 1.09-1.47 per 1,000 LB). We did not find a conclusive trend over time in IHPS incidence. Differences in incidence between season of birth and season of surgery were not significant (

 = 0.677 and

 = 0.206, respectively).

 We found an average IHPS incidence of 1.28 per 1,000 LB in the Netherlands. Our results showed no changing trend in incidence and no seasonal variation.

 The utility of mucous fistula refeeding (MFR) in neonates with short bowel syndrome is widely debated. Our purpose is to review MFR and outline methods, reported complications, and clinical outcomes (survival, weight gain, dependence on parenteral nutrition [PN], and time to enteral autonomy).

 We performed a MEDLINE literature search and reference review from January 1980 to May 2020 for terms ("mucous fistula re-feeding" or "enteral re-feeding") and neonates. We included studies that utilized conventional MFR in the neonatal period. Non-English language articles were excluded.

 We identified 11 relevant articles. Internationally, there was no consensus on methods of MFR. A total of 197 neonates underwent MFR. Within a single study, four neonates developed major complications; however, the procedure was well tolerated without major complications in 10 of the 11 studies. A mortality of nine patients during MFR highlights the burden of disease within the study population; however, of these, only one was directly attributable to MFR. Minor complications were seldom quantified. Three studies demonstrated a higher rate of weight gain and shorter PN support versus controls. Neonates who underwent MFR had lower chance of anastomotic leak and quicker progression to full feed after reversal versus controls. The influence of microorganisms in MFR was only investigated in one study.

 Current evidence suggests benefits of MFR; however, an international consensus is yet to be reached on the optimal method. A large prospective study investigating the influence of MFR on the enteric system is required.

The objective of this study was to investigate the association of GALNT2 rs2144300 and rs4846914 single nucleotide polymorphisms (SNPs) with the risk of polycystic ovary syndrome (PCOS) and related traits. The two SNPs were genotyped in 616 PCOS patients and 482 control subjects. Genetic associations with related traits were also analyzed. The genotype distributions of the two SNPs in PCOS patients were similar to those of normal controls. However, significant differences were noted across the three groups of genotypes with respect to the examined variables. In the PCOS group, subjects with genotype AA at the rs4846914 SNP exhibited an increased fasting serum insulin and homeostasis model insulin resistance (HOMA-IR) index compared with that of corresponding GG or GA genotype carriers (all P  less then  0.05). When PCOS patients were further separated into obese and non-obese subgroups, the genotype-related effects on insulin and HOMA-IR were more obvious, and variations in BMI and FSH levels were exclusively observed in obese PCOS subjects (all P  less then  0.05). In addition, fasting plasma glucose levels were affected by the genotypes of the rs2144300 SNP in normal control women (P  less then  0.05). rs4846914 and rs2144300 polymorphisms in the GALNT2 gene are associated with insulin and HOMA-IR, BMI, and FSH levels in obese PCOS patients and glucose levels in normal control women, respectively, but not with PCOS. In the authors' extensive experience observing representative users interact with medical devices in simulated-use studies, individuals' engagement with medical device IFUs varies widely. This variance raises questions regarding how various user groups use IFUs and the factors that make an IFU stronger or weaker for its intended users, uses, and use environments. An online survey was conducted to examine (1) first-time use of medical device IFUs, (2) how first-time use strategies vary across typical user groups for medical devices (e.g., patients, lay caregivers, and healthcare professionals), and (3) which design elements promote initial engagement with IFUs. The results showed that IFUs are used in a variety of ways, including as preparation before use, as guides during use, and as troubleshooting resources during use, as well as that IFUs are not used at all.
